Jun 18, 2025
Bmclane
4 out of 5 stars review

So far so good

I'm on hour 10 of break-in, so I've only run it up to 2,300 watts. Seems solid so far. The only issue is that the starter stays engaged around 5 seconds after the engine turns over. It's not enough of an issue for me to deal with any sort of a claim, but it's an issue nonetheless.

Jul 30, 2025
RWnSC
5 out of 5 stars review

Great Option for Emergency Power

Fortunately I have only ran the unit for the break-in period and have not needed it in an emergency situation yet. Generator performs as described. Very quiet running unit. Easy to use. The dual fuel capability is very convenient. You do need to keep the battery trickle charger connect and plugged into a wall outlet to make sure battery is charged when the time comes that you need to use the Generator, because it will not start if the battery is dead not even with the pull start.
